1. Major characters given personalities diametrically opposite to how Tolkien created them...eg Tolkien-Theoden "kindly old man" while film-Theoden angry and bitter, in fact playing the role of book-Denethor;
meanwhile Denethor himself - a leader who in the book did his utmost to defend Gondor, ordering the beacons to be lit and the Arrow to summon Rohan: "tall, valiant, more kingly than any man that had appeared in Gondor for many lives of men") turned into a drooling Nero-esque sybarite.

2. Major characters who were not actually transformed were trivialised and made oafish (Gimli, Merry, Pippin) or embarrassingly wet and over-emotional. (Frodo, Eowyn)

3. The stupid Arwen-into-horse scene in TT (didn't actually mind the Arwen-on-horse in FotR)

4. The stupid Treebeard-tricking in TT

5. The stupid Arwen-is-leaving-then-dying thing in TT
